How to Pick the Right LPN School near Hainesport New Jersey

Hainesport NJ LPN pediatric nurse holding infantThere are principally two academic credentials available that provide education to become an LPN near Hainesport NJ. The one that may be completed in the shortest time period, normally about one year, is the certificate or diploma program. The next option is to attain a Practical Nursing Associate Degree. These LPN programs are more comprehensive in nature than the diploma alternative and commonly require 2 years to complete. The advantage of Associate Degrees, in addition to offering a higher credential and more comprehensive instruction, are that they provide more transferable credit toward a Bachelor’s Degree in nursing. Regardless of the kind of credential you pursue, it needs to be state approved and accredited by the National League for Nursing Accrediting Commission (NLNAC) or any other national accrediting organization. The NLNAC attests that the core curriculum properly prepares students to become Practical Nurses, and that the majority of graduates pass the 50 state required NCLEX-PN licensing exam.

What is an LPN?

Hainesport NJ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N)Licensed Practical Nurses have a number of functions that they perform in the Hainesport NJ health care facilities where they practice. As their titles imply, they are mandated to be licensed in all states, including New Jersey. Even though they may be responsible for managing Certified Nursing Assistants (CNA), they themselves typically work under the supervision of either an RN or a doctor. The medical facilities where they work are numerous and assorted, for instance hospitals, medical clinics, schools, and long-term care facilities. Virtually any place that you can find patients requiring medical assistance is their dominion. Each state not only controls their licensing, but also what functions an LPN can and can’t perform. So based on the state, their day-to-day job functions might include:

  • Checking vital signs
  • Providing medicines
  • Initiating IV drips
  • Observing patients
  • Collecting blood or urine samples
  • Taking care of patient records
  • Helping doctors or RNs with procedures

Along with their occupational functions being governed by each state, the health facilities or other Hainesport NJ healthcare providers where LPNs work can additionally limit their job roles within those parameters. In addition, they can work in different specialties of nursing, including long-term care, critical care, oncology and cardiology.

LPN Salary

According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ual wage for Licensed Practical Nurses (LPN) was $45,030 in May 2017. The median wage is the wage at which half the workers in an occupation earned more than that amount and half earned less. The lowest 10 percent earned less than $32,970, and the highest 10 percent earned more than $61,030. Most licensed practical nurses near Hainesport NJ work full time, although about 1 in 5 worked part time in 2016. Many work nights, weekends, and holidays, because medical care takes place at all hours. They may be required to work shifts of longer than 8 hours. Employment of LPNs is projected to grow 12 percent from 2016 to 2026.  Job prospects should be favorable for LPNs who are willing to work in rural and medically under served areas.

Things to Ask LPN Schools

Questions to ask Hainesport NJ LPN programsOnce you have decided on obtaining your LPN certificate, and if you will attend classes on campus or online, you can use the following guidelines to begin narrowing down your options. As you probably are aware, there are numerous nursing schools and colleges near Hainesport NJ as well as within New Jersey and throughout the United States. So it is important to reduce the number of schools to select from in order that you will have a workable list. As we already pointed out, the site of the school and the price of tuition are undoubtedly going to be the first two factors that you will take into consideration. But as we also emphasized, they should not be your sole qualifiers. So prior to making your final choice, use the following questions to evaluate how your selection compares to the other programs.

  • Accreditation. It’s a good idea to make sure that the certificate program in addition to the school are accredited by a U.S. Department of Education recognized accrediting organization. In addition to helping confirm that you receive a premium education, it may assist in securing financial aid or student loans, which are frequently not available for non-accredited schools near Hainesport NJ.
  • Licensing Preparation. Licensing prerequisites for LPNs are different from state to state. In all states, a passing score is needed on the National Council Licensure Examination (NCLEX-PN) as well as graduation from an accredited school. Certain states require a certain number of clinical hours be performed, as well as the passing of additional tests. It’s important that the school you are enrolled in not only delivers an outstanding education, but also preps you to comply with the minimum licensing requirements for New Jersey or the state where you will be practicing.
  • Reputation. Look at internet rating services to see what the evaluations are for each of the LPN schools you are considering. Ask the accrediting organizations for their reviews as well. In addition, get in touch with the New Jersey school licensing authority to check out if there are any complaints or compliance issues. Finally, you can speak with some local Hainesport NJ healthcare organizations you’re interested in working for after graduation and ask what their judgements are of the schools as well.
  • Graduation and Job Placement Rates. Find out from the LPN schools you are looking at what their graduation rates are as well as how long on average it takes students to finish their programs. A low graduation rate may be an indication that students were displeased with the program and dropped out. It’s also important that the schools have high job placement rates. A high rate will not only substantiate that the school has a superb reputation within the Hainesport NJ healthcare community, but that it also has the network of contacts to assist students attain a position.
  • Internship Programs. The most ideal way to get experience as a Licensed Practical Nurse is to work in a clinical environment. Essentially all nursing degree programs require a specified number of clinical hours be completed. Many states have minimum clinical hour prerequisites for licensing as well. Ask if the schools have a working relationship with nearby Hainesport NJ community hospitals, clinics or labs and help with the placing of students in internships.

Hainesport Township, New Jersey

Hainesport Township is a township in Burlington County, New Jersey, United States. As of the 2010 United States Census, the township's population was 6,110,[8][9][10] reflecting an increase of 1,984 (+48.1%) from the 4,126 counted in the 2000 Census, which had in turn increased by 877 (+27.0%) from the 3,249 counted in the 1990 Census.[19]

In 1778, the township was the site of a skirmish during the American Revolutionary War, when American rebels fired upon Hessian soldiers after they were halted by the dismantling of a bridge over the Rancocas.[20][21]

Hainesport Township was incorporated as a township by an act of the New Jersey Legislature on March 12, 1924, from portions of Lumberton Township.[22] The township was named for Barclay Haines, who bought property in the area and established a wharf near his home on the Rancocas Creek.[20][23]
